I am powerless to resist a vintage chronograph in good shape, particularly if it has an original or whimsical element to the design. Here's an Eska - brand name of S. Kocher, "ess-Ka" being the way you would pronounce the initials of the manufacturer in German. It's not a brand with a particularly distinguished reputation - an etablisseur (watch assembler) rather than a manufacture - but I always watch out for Eskas because there is often something quirky or weird (good-weird!) about their designs.In favor of the purchase: - The contrast between blue hands and bronze face - Batman hands! - A dial strongly reminiscent of a Vacheron that once caught my eye - odd flanged lugs - pretty decent shape overall - 38mm - really decent price on the 'bay...who collects Eska?Against the purchase - couldn't think of anything
